Canadian sawmill production dips 6.6% month-over-month in June

Posted on September 11, 2023   |  

In June, lumber production fell monthly by 6.6% to 3,744.2 thousand m³, and annually, sawmill production fell by 16.8%.

In the same period, Canadian sawmills shipped 4,169.2 thousand m³ of lumber, an increase of 0.3% from May but a drop of 8.2% from June 2022.
